Embracing the Coastal Heart: Beaches and Waterfronts

The primary draw of Clearwater is, undeniably, its iconic coastline, where sugar-white sand meets the warm, emerald waters of the Gulf of Mexico. Clearwater Beach stretches for miles, a meticulously maintained ribbon of leisure that caters to every mood, whether you seek a quiet spot for solitary reflection or a bustling scene filled with beach volleyball and music. Unlike the chaotic energy of some resort hubs, the vibe here strikes a balance between lively and relaxed, allowing visitors to easily find their rhythm. The gentle slope of the seabed makes it exceptionally safe for families, while the consistently clear waters are a snorkeler’s dream, offering glimpses of tropical fish and sea grass beds just below the surface.
Dolphin Watching and Marine Adventures

No visit is complete without an encounter with the area’s most celebrated residents: the bottlenose dolphins. Numerous local operators offer eco-friendly cruises designed for observation rather than disruption, ensuring these majestic creatures can thrive while guests enjoy unforgettable proximity. These trips transform a simple boat ride into a moving wildlife spectacle, as playful dolphins surface alongside the vessel, performing natural behaviors that spark genuine awe. For those looking to participate rather than observe, paddleboarding and kayaking provide a serene yet thrilling way to navigate the Intracoastal Waterway, turning a standard afternoon into a personal exploration of the region’s delicate aquatic ecosystem.

Outdoor Recreation and Day Trips
For the adventure-minded, the terrain surrounding Clearwater offers a surprising variety of outdoor activities that cater to both thrill-seekers and nature lovers. Fort De Soto Park, located just a short drive away, is a sprawling paradise of pristine beaches, dense mangrove forests, and historical forts, providing endless opportunities for hiking, cycling, and wildlife photography. The park’s distinct ecosystems allow visitors to transition from a bustling beach picnic to a tranquil hike through secluded forests within a single day. Furthermore, the proximity to Tampa enables easy access to major league sports, world-class museums, and the vibrant Theater District, making the region an ideal base for a multifaceted vacation.
